Dominion Sues Mike Lindell and My Pillow, Inc.

Mike Lindell has been calling on Dominion Voting Systems to sue him so that a court of law could look at the evidence of election fraud that he has amassed. On February 22, 2021 Mike Lindell and My Pillow, Inc. were finally sued by Dominion Voting Systems. The suit alleges that Lindell “exploited” the 2020 election to sell pillows.
